We recently spent Memorial Day weekend camping here at this private campground. It is near Grand Rapids, Michigan. The location is very convenient for accessing attractions in GR, or mid-western side of MI. The Rogue and Grand Rivers meet here, and is convenient for canoeing, boating, tubing etc. We could not do this however, due to winds and rain. There are several golf courses nearby. The campground has very clean restrooms. They have nice green grass, and large shade trees. However, their lake is not what is described in the brochure, the same with the beach, playground, and get-togethers. The rib cookout they had was not what we had expected-we thought this was a chance to socialize with other campers under the pavilion-it was not. The pavilion has very little seating, and is quite messy. There are also ping pong tables (in bad shape) under the pavilion, as well as some other games. The gardening needs to be better maintained, and the roads are pretty bad-especially after it rains! They said they run a tight ship-but there was lots of noise after the 10-ll PM Quiet Time, a lot of dogs barking, and no one was at the gate except on Sunday. The owners are very friendly. They escort you to your site, but we had waited for several minutes as instructed, and no one came, so off we went on our own, in the dark. The did find us and talk to us, giving some advice and showing us where the water hookups were etc. So, convenient for being tourists, not so great if you are in the campground all the time.. …
